Output a9518c95e220fafd32b24180d76d53d375760c74b04201bfccf567f56add0220:1

value
1660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 103ff9f4f89fb892f3faea828498bc97c802e337 OP_EQUALVERIFY OP_CHECKSIG
address
12UvTEAv7WD6GeB2ibkxD1kf8HLi98iUEw
transaction
a9518c95e220fafd32b24180d76d53d375760c74b04201bfccf567f56add0220
spent
true